Down to Earth

[BE THE FIRST TO RATE THIS MOVIE]
Calorie Rating: 142
Released: 1947-08-21
Running Time: 101 Minutes
Studios: Columbia Pictures,


Upset at a new Broadway musical mocking The Nine Muses, Greek goddess Terpsichore comes down to earth to land a part in the show and change it.
